Theory of Elasticity and Plasticity
is a fundamental concept in mechanics of materials, essential for engineers and researchers to understand the behavior of materials under various loads. This graduate certificate program aims to equip students with a deep understanding of the theoretical foundations of elasticity and plasticity, including stress analysis and strain theory. By exploring the relationships between stress, strain, and material properties, students will gain a comprehensive knowledge of the subject. Some key topics covered in the program include creep, fatigue, and fracture mechanics.
